(-) Description

Title :  THE ATOMIC STRUCTURE OF THE DEGRADED PROCAPSID PARTICLE OF THE BACTERIOPHAGE G4: INDUCED STRUCTURAL CHANGES IN THE PRESENCE OF CALCIUM IONS AND FUNCTIONAL IMPLICATIONS
 
Authors :  M. G. Rossmann
Date :  06 Nov 95  (Deposition) - 03 Apr 96  (Release) - 24 Feb 09  (Revision)
Method :  X-RAY DIFFRACTION
Resolution :  3.00
Chains :  Asym. Unit :  1,2,3
Biol. Unit 1:  1,2,3  (60x)
Keywords :  Coat Protein, Icosahedral Virus (Keyword Search: [Gene Ontology, PubMed, Web (Google))
 
Reference :  R. Mckenna, B. R. Bowman, L. L. Ilag, M. G. Rossmann, B. A. Fane
Atomic Structure Of The Degraded Procapsid Particle Of The Bacteriophage G4: Induced Structural Changes In The Presence Of Calcium Ions And Functional Implications.
J. Mol. Biol. V. 256 736 1996
PubMed-ID: 8642594  |  Reference-DOI: 10.1006/JMBI.1996.0121
